I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Python Discussion :

Serveur d'applications Python


Sujet :

Python

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Inscrit en
    Mars 2009
    Messages
    87
    Détails du profil
    Informations forums :
    Inscription : Mars 2009
    Messages : 87
    Par défaut Serveur d'applications Python
    Bonjour,

    J'ai développé une bibliothèque de scripts techniques en python. La majorité des scripts sont des programmes de post traitement avec des inputs (fichiers) et des outputs (fichiers). Aujourd'hui, je fais tourner les scripts sur ma machine mais j'aimerai les mettre à disposition d'utilisateurs sur un serveur d'applications où par exemple, je pourrais les classer par dossier, paramétrer les accès, paramétrer des logs, suivre les exécutions (quoi, qui, durée, arguments), les plannifier, suivre une queue de traitement.
    Connaissez un projet ou produit qui permettrait de faire ce genre de serveur d'applications ?

    Merci

  2. #2
    Expert confirmé
    Avatar de fred1599
    Homme Profil pro
    Lead Dev Python
    Inscrit en
    Juillet 2006
    Messages
    4 062
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Meurthe et Moselle (Lorraine)

    Informations professionnelles :
    Activité : Lead Dev Python
    Secteur : Arts - Culture

    Informations forums :
    Inscription : Juillet 2006
    Messages : 4 062
    Par défaut
    Bonjour,

    Tout dépend de la manière dont vous souhaitez que l'utilisateur accède à vos programmes (Web, ssh, ...)

    En tout cas l'expression du besoin devait être faîte bien avant la mise en exercice du développement, vous risquez selon votre choix d'avoir des problèmes à adapter votre code.

  3. #3
    Expert éminent
    Homme Profil pro
    Architecte technique retraité
    Inscrit en
    Juin 2008
    Messages
    21 743
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Manche (Basse Normandie)

    Informations professionnelles :
    Activité : Architecte technique retraité
    Secteur : Industrie

    Informations forums :
    Inscription : Juin 2008
    Messages : 21 743
    Par défaut
    Salut,

    Citation Envoyé par fred1599 Voir le message
    En tout cas l'expression du besoin devait être faîte bien avant la mise en exercice du développement
    Pour ce que j'en comprends, le besoin serait plutôt de récupérer un serveur d'application qui... pas de le développer.

    Mais ce n'est pas si clair puisque ce genre de question n'a pas grand chose à faire dans un forum de développeurs Python: si un tel engin existe, qu'il ait été écrit avec Python n'apporte pas grand chose...

    - W
    Architectures post-modernes.
    Python sur DVP c'est aussi des FAQs, des cours et tutoriels

  4. #4
    Membre confirmé
    Inscrit en
    Mars 2009
    Messages
    87
    Détails du profil
    Informations forums :
    Inscription : Mars 2009
    Messages : 87
    Par défaut
    Bonjour,

    Oui, je pensais effectivement à une solution web.
    Je suis conscient que la mise en place de cette solution nécessitera de revoir les scripts mais ça n'est pas un problème.
    Si une solution de ce type existe déjà, évidemment je ne souhaite pas re-inventer la roue.
    Effectivement on est pas sur une question python pure, mais qui mieux que Renault peut entretenir votre Renault 😁

    Merci

  5. #5
    Expert confirmé
    Avatar de fred1599
    Homme Profil pro
    Lead Dev Python
    Inscrit en
    Juillet 2006
    Messages
    4 062
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Meurthe et Moselle (Lorraine)

    Informations professionnelles :
    Activité : Lead Dev Python
    Secteur : Arts - Culture

    Informations forums :
    Inscription : Juillet 2006
    Messages : 4 062
    Par défaut
    Bonjour,

    Pour une solution web, vous avez des serveurs HTTP (applicatifs) qui existent en nombre.
    • Flask
    • Django
    • Bottle
    • CherryPy
    • ...

  6. #6
    Expert éminent
    Homme Profil pro
    Architecte technique retraité
    Inscrit en
    Juin 2008
    Messages
    21 743
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Manche (Basse Normandie)

    Informations professionnelles :
    Activité : Architecte technique retraité
    Secteur : Industrie

    Informations forums :
    Inscription : Juin 2008
    Messages : 21 743
    Par défaut
    Salut,

    Citation Envoyé par fufurax Voir le message
    Si une solution de ce type existe déjà, évidemment je ne souhaite pas re-inventer la roue
    Ce que vous cherchez ressemble à un système de batch accessible depuis le Web.
    Si vous cherchez un peu sur Internet avec ces mots clefs "web batch engine", vous allez trouver plein de solutions +/- prêtes à l'emploi car c'est une technologie qui s'utilise beaucoup dans l'analyse massive des données (le big data).

    Une solution comme Apache Spark est probablement "surdimensionnée" mais ça donne une idée de l'architecture de ce genre d'engin et donc des différents composants/fonctionnalités à intégrer pour le construire.
    note: après trouver le truc qui corresponde le mieux à vos besoins, il n'y a que vous qui puissiez regarder/choisir/tester...

    - W
    Architectures post-modernes.
    Python sur DVP c'est aussi des FAQs, des cours et tutoriels

Discussions similaires

  1. Application python à exécuter sur un serveur
    Par maxlb55 dans le forum Général Python
    Réponses: 2
    Dernier message: 02/02/2020, 13h20
  2. [Serveur J2EE] Faire tourner un thread dans un serveur d'applications
    Par Pierre-Yves VAROUX dans le forum Java EE
    Réponses: 3
    Dernier message: 13/10/2005, 14h10
  3. Différence entre SGBD et Serveur d'application
    Par WOLO Laurent dans le forum Langage SQL
    Réponses: 2
    Dernier message: 30/06/2003, 08h47
  4. Serveur d'applications Java
    Par foxrol dans le forum Java EE
    Réponses: 3
    Dernier message: 17/05/2003, 00h49
  5. serveur d'application
    Par nass_03 dans le forum JBuilder
    Réponses: 3
    Dernier message: 20/01/2003, 16h34

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o